OK, so we now know that the movie has some significant changes from the book:

1. No Dumbledore Funeral (although it was filmed)
2. No "Battle" at Hogwarts (tower sequence?)
3. No Rufus Scrimgeour character scenes (still mentioned?)


They're also going to have to do something more with Kreacher and Dobby as a set up for Film 7.1 and 7.2, but nothing has been heard of what is going on with those, at least not from the articles I've read.
